Re: "The Super Eagles Thread: The Road To AFCON 2027, 2028 And 2030 World Cup by TheSuperNerd(m): 10:59am On Sep 29, 2024
Before he began blowing up, this thread did justice to making him visible. Myself and a couple other monikers already mentioned him before his EPL debut in 22/23 season, 2 seasons ago. We also graced the thread with his record breaking debut which lasted a few mins.

If we had moved on him then, we may have stood a chance but right now ain't no way we are bagging him especially with Bukayo Saka as the kid's mentor.

Saka wanted us for a bit initially but then changed his mind when he saw he had a real chance with England. I understand Saka. And I knew instantly Saka will have a longer lasting England career than Tammy, Tomori, Solanke, EZE and co.

Now same Saka is Captain of Arsenal in Odegaard's absence and another Anglo-Nigerian like himself with high potential, Ethan Nwaneri is finally having his breakthrough season after his EPL debut 2 seasons ago, Omo, ain't no way England are losing this guy unless the hype drops.


Verdict: The NFF should have a mega active scouting and recruitment dept division focused on the dual nationals who can approach them early and see how we can commit them early before the hype comes. Those who will commit, will commit. Those who won't do so, won't do so. But understand, some of these kids also understand that playing for a Euro youth side (England U17, France U17, etc) betters their chances of being considered at their clubs as they climb up the ladder of their careers so some won't commit based on this angle alone.

Re: "The Super Eagles Thread: The Road To AFCON 2027, 2028 And 2030 World Cup by Amedino99(m): 11:20am On Sep 29, 2024
Mujtahida:
We have to get that Nwaneri guy. We have to. Can't we get a super talented player choosing us from the get-go?
when you compare the benefits of playing for top European nations as against playing, the decision is not really difficult to make because what exactly does Nigeria have as leverage to offer to a foreign youth player that will make playing for us more attractive? For a player born in Europe I don't know how you will convince him winning the afcon is equally as impressive as winning the euros. Added again is the fact that as a continent we are still celebrating making the world cup semi finals which is our highest achievement. More reason we have to be more intentional about our home based talents.
